Andrew, the protagonist of the story Birth, utters these words as he is able to bring a still born child back to life which seemed impossible in the beginning. The child is born still to the wife of Joe Morgan. But after feverish efforts Andrew is able to bring the child back to the life. He utters these words out of deep satisfaction on achieving the seemingly impossible task. It means that Andrew has been able to do something wonderful. He has been able to apply whatever he learnt in the medical textbooks and even beyond that. It is really a great achievement for Andrew.
